Login

Subversion Repositories NedoOS

Rev

Show changed files | Details | Compare with Previous | Blame | RSS feed

Filtering Options

Rev Age Author Path Log message Diff
1410 2022-04-09 10:11:29 alone /src/cmd/cmd.asm  
1301 2021-09-19 22:24:43 alone /src/cmd/cmd.asm *cmd: после вызова программы не печатается её результат
+nv: после вызова программы с выходом по стрелке ничего не печатается, чтобы быстрее листать картинки
 
1299 2021-09-17 22:43:26 alone /src/cmd/cmd.asm +cmd: переименование расширения: ren *.расш1 *.расш2  
1298 2021-09-15 21:18:50 alone /src/cmd/cmd.asm +cmd: proc выводит число занятых страниц у каждой задачи (NS)  
1196 2021-08-08 16:41:45 alone /src/cmd/cmd.asm +nv: если вызванная программа вернула код стрелки, то после выхода из неё курсор двигается вниз или вверх и автоматически нажимается Enter (NEO SPECTRUMAN)
*cmd: для этого возвращает результат последней запущенной программы (т.к. ассоциации в nv исполняются через cmd - или не надо так?)
 
1123 2021-07-01 18:31:59 alone /src/cmd/cmd.asm +x86: ускорено 16-битное adc/sbc с флагами (NEO SPECTRUMAN)
+kernel: ускорен вызов функций (Sayman)
+cmd: добавлена команда cls (Grey)
-ufo2: исправлен показ начальной заставки
 
979 2021-04-17 18:21:12 alone /src/cmd/cmd.asm -cmd: при запуске программ выставлял системную директорию
-uwol: при компиляции писал ошибку (не влияла на результат)
-sprexamp: при компиляции писал ошибку
+добавлен отдельный батник для ATM2 со свободными страницами 0,4,6,0x1b..0x1f,0x38 (для игр touhou-zero и innsmouth), а в mkatm2hd.bat эти страницы не используются
-touhou-zero: убраны лишние файлы
 
875 2021-02-01 18:56:49 alone /src/cmd/cmd.asm -kernel: случайно освобождал pgkillable
*kernel: OS_WAITPID переименована в OS_CHECKPID, потому что ничего не ждёт
+kernel: теперь QUIT (равно как и OS_HIDEFROMPARENT) имеет параметр hl=result. он возвращается родителю по WAITPID в hl
*cmd: показывает результат вызова программы
 
851 2021-01-19 21:50:06 alone /src/cmd/cmd.asm -cmd,nv: нельзя было вводить команду длиннее экрана
-makeall: не собирал некоторые файлы
 
816 2020-11-22 16:57:34 alone /src/cmd/cmd.asm -nv: не работало удаление подкаталогов (Slip) (однако при большом их количестве может понадобиться вторая попытка удаления)
-cmd: увеличен буфер копирования, а то тормозило (Sayman)
-kernel: установка времени после копирования файла не работала
-barbarian, midnight: убраны ошибки компиляции
 
680 2020-09-15 17:56:33 alone /src/cmd/cmd.asm +bdsc: добавлена утилита concat.c (сборка: cc concat.c, clink concat, использование: concat outfile infile1 infile2)
*cmd: параметры %1... не заменяются из командной строки, только в батнике. Также в батнике поддержаны команды с | и >
 
665 2020-09-09 21:54:38 alone /src/cmd/cmd.asm -cmd: повторно запускалась программа из параметра
-pt: исправлено запарывание кода при исчезании стрелки
 
656 2020-09-06 23:20:51 alone /src/cmd/cmd.asm +nv: поиск по вложенным директориям  
652 2020-09-03 08:45:30 dimkam /src/cmd/cmd.asm cmd: в dir можно указывать путь  
645 2020-08-30 12:42:34 alone /src/cmd/cmd.asm *cmd: dir выводит имя справа, чтобы не было криво  
644 2020-08-30 12:37:34 alone /src/cmd/cmd.asm +cmd: dir поддерживает длинные имена  
637 2020-08-27 18:20:06 alone /src/cmd/cmd.asm +nedolang: константные выражения +(expr) - тип выражения определяется по левому контексту. В исходниках почищена такая же устаревшая запись тайпкаста.
+cmd: %0..%9 - параметры при вызове батника
+bdsc: исправлен getchar, написан батник сборки сишника (cc.bat)
 
631 2020-08-25 13:03:43 alone /src/cmd/cmd.asm -исправлены неправильные автозамены прошлой версии
*cmd,nv,scratch: читают-пишут файлы только через хэндлы, а CP/M-функции только для чтения директории
+idle: ускорена отрисовка заставки
-reset: не устанавливалась палитра
 
630 2020-08-24 23:32:39 alone /src/cmd/cmd.asm +nedolang: evar {UINT var1 = 1, INT var2 = 2, FLOAT var3} и т.п. создаёт переменные заданого типа с заданными адресами
+bdsc: начинаем портировать компилятор C (пока не работает, но уже ругается)
 
613 2020-08-19 20:25:43 alone /src/cmd/cmd.asm +cmd: more < filename.txt (more сам закрывает файл, cmd не может отследить момент ненужности)  

Show All